I, too, was given the business by NADN's supposed tax credit MallForAll business. I did not recieve the full tax credit that was promised to me. Nor, was I informed that I was in a tax bracket that would not benefit from this credit.

I also was charge $505.00 for a Tax Preparation fee that I was not advised of. My Invoice indicates that all the money I paid was for the business. NADN said that they would send me a refund of $505.00. To date, I have not received the refund. NADN will not return my calls. Buyer beware!

Received my $505.00 refund today. However, NADN is still not returning my calls re: MallFORALL Business. I prepared my taxes, and could only receive an additional $896.00 in refund $$$$ by applying the ADA credit.

I spoke with a tax preparer at NADN and he said that my income level was too high to receive full benefit. When I asked why I was sold this, he said,"they don't know this down there". Meaning Sales.

So, I paid $2500. for a business that was supposed to increase my refund by over $5000.00. I only got back $896.00. So I am in the red for over $1600.00. Nice!!!!I guess there are no disclosure laws for NADN.

Actually, they can keep the routing number of your bank and account number of your account, but any transfer out of said account must be initiated by the account holder from the specific bank branch.

One thing that may scare you is that with only one more piece of information (your SSN) they have a chance of accessing your account online. If you have an account which offers online banking, and you haven't created a username and password, they can do it in your name...and have full access to your account.

The safest thing you can do right now is have your bank change your account number and (if possible) decline online banking or go ahead and create your username and password (make it a random number, not anything easily cracked) and keep it locked away.
